How it works

Host, invite, play

Step 1

Host a private battle

Tap Host. We create a room that only your friend can enter.

Step 2

Invite by link or code

Copy the link or the six-character code and send it however you like.

Step 3

Play, straight-faced

Once you’re both ready, the round starts. First to break a smile loses a point.

FAQ

A few common questions

Do I need an account?

Yes — hosting or joining a battle requires signing in, so rooms stay accountable and moderatable.

Can strangers match with me?

No. Smile Battle is private, invite-only rooms — there’s no random matchmaking.

What do you do with my camera?

Video stays between you and your friend during the battle; it’s explained fully before we ever ask for camera access.
